package razel
import (
"fmt"
"log"
"path"
"sort"
"strings"
"github.com/bazelbuild/bazel-gazelle/config"
"github.com/bazelbuild/bazel-gazelle/label"
"github.com/bazelbuild/bazel-gazelle/repo"
"github.com/bazelbuild/bazel-gazelle/resolve"
"github.com/bazelbuild/bazel-gazelle/rule"
)
const rName = "R"
type pkgImports struct {
pkgName string
pkgDeps, pkgSuggestedDeps []string
}
func (rLang) Name() string {
return rName
}
func (rLang) Imports(_ *config.Config, r *rule.Rule, f *rule.File) []resolve.ImportSpec {
if r.Kind() != "r_pkg" {
return nil
}
pkgName := pkgName(r, f)
return []resolve.ImportSpec{{
Lang: rName,
Imp: pkgName,
}}
}
func (rLang) Embeds(*rule.Rule, label.Label) []label.Label {
return nil
}
func (rLang) Resolve(c *config.Config, ix *resolve.RuleIndex, _ *repo.RemoteCache,
r *rule.Rule, imports interface{}, from label.Label) {
pkgImports := imports.(pkgImports)
pkgLabels := resolveRDeps(c, ix, from, []string{pkgImports.pkgName})
pkgDeps := resolveRDeps(c, ix, from, pkgImports.pkgDeps)
pkgSuggestedDeps := resolveRDeps(c, ix, from, pkgImports.pkgSuggestedDeps)
if len(pkgLabels) != 1 {
panic(fmt.Sprintf("package %q must have exactly 1 label, but got %#v", pkgImports.pkgName, pkgLabels))
}
pkgLabel := pkgLabels[0]
switch r.Kind() {
case "r_pkg":
// Do nothing.
case "r_unit_test", "r_pkg_test":
r.SetAttr("pkg", pkgLabel)
case "r_library":
switch r.Name() {
case "library":
r.SetAttr("pkgs", []string{pkgLabel})
case "deps":
if len(pkgDeps) > 0 {
r.SetAttr("pkgs", pkgDeps)
} else {
r.DelAttr("pkgs")
}
case "suggested_deps":
if len(pkgSuggestedDeps) > 0 {
r.SetAttr("pkgs", pkgSuggestedDeps)
} else {
r.DelAttr("pkgs")
}
}
default:
log.Printf("unknown rule kind %s for resolve step", r.Kind())
}
}
func resolveRDeps(c *config.Config, ix *resolve.RuleIndex, from label.Label, deps []string) []string {
var labels []string
rCfg := getRConfig(c)
for _, dep := range deps {
// TODO: Use FindRulesByImportWithConfig when we update minimum gazelle version.
res := ix.FindRulesByImport(resolve.ImportSpec{Lang: rName, Imp: dep}, rName)
if len(res) == 0 {
// External dependency.
labels = append(labels, "@"+rCfg.externalDepPrefix+strings.ReplaceAll(dep, ".", "_"))
continue
}
if len(res) > 1 {
log.Printf("multiple resolutions found for R package %q: %#v", dep, res)
}
label := res[0].Label
if label.Name == "" {
// This can happen when the label name is not a string constant in the
// BUILD file. So let's use a heuristic to guess the label name.
label.Name = path.Base(label.Pkg)
}
labels = append(labels, label.Rel(from.Repo, from.Pkg).String())
}
sort.Strings(labels)
return labels
}
